Which platforms does Publish cover?
Four destinations: LinkedIn, X, Facebook and Instagram. LinkedIn and X publish today. Facebook and Instagram are built but do not publish for customers yet, because Meta declined pages_manage_posts and instagram_content_publish at App Review; the composer greys those destinations out rather than letting you write a post it cannot send. Google and Snapchat are ad platforms only, so Publish has never posted to them.
How does scheduling work?
Pick a date and time. We queue the post and fire it through the platform API at the scheduled moment, with retries if the API is temporarily down. Queued, live, and failed states all show in the calendar view.
How does boosting work?
Publish records the boost, it does not place it. When you boost a winning post in the ad platform, link it to that campaign in overads and the paid results land beside the organic ones: spend, conversions, and the CRM cash attributed to that campaign, on the same row as the post that started it. overads does not create the campaign, set a budget or pick an audience, because it holds no write access to your ad accounts today.
How does time zone handling work?
Every workspace has a default time zone, and each post can override it. The composer shows both the scheduled local time and your team's time, so nothing posts at 3am by accident.
Can my team collaborate on drafts?
Yes. Drafts are workspace-scoped with comment threads on every draft. On Scale, approval workflows mean a draft cannot publish until a named approver signs off.
Do you scrape or use unofficial APIs?
No. Every connection is OAuth through the official platform API. No scraping, no ToS-violating automation, no risk of your accounts getting banned.
What does Publish cost?
Publish is part of the overads superapp and included on every plan: Starter $49/mo, Growth $149/mo, Scale $299/mo. There is no cap on connected accounts or scheduled posts on any tier; approval workflows are the one Publish feature that is Scale-only.
How are my tokens stored?
OAuth tokens are encrypted at rest with AWS KMS, scoped to your workspace, and never logged. Disconnecting a platform revokes the grant immediately.
